Ingredients

  • 500g pre-cooked lasagna pasta

  • 500g ground meat (can be beef, chicken, or a mixture of both)

  • 1 medium onion, chopped

  • 2 garlic cloves, chopped

  • 500ml tomato sauce

  • 2 tablespoons olive oil

  • Salt and pepper to taste

  • 500g grated mozzarella cheese

  • 50g grated parmesan cheese

  • Fresh basil leaves for garnish (optional)

Directions

  • Preheat the oven to 180°C.
  • In a large pan, heat the olive oil over medium heat. Add the chopped onion and garlic and sauté until golden.
  • Add the ground beef to the pan and cook until it is completely browned and there are no longer any pink spots.
  • Season the meat with salt and pepper to taste and add the tomato sauce. Let the mixture cook over low heat for about 10-15 minutes, stirring occasionally, so the flavors blend well.
  • In a baking dish, spread a thin layer of meat sauce on the bottom. Then place a layer of lasagna noodles over the sauce.
  • Cover the pasta with a layer of grated mozzarella cheese and then a layer of meat sauce.
  • Repeat the layers, alternating between pasta, mozzarella cheese and meat sauce, until all ingredients have been used. Make sure to finish with a layer of meat sauce on top.
  • Sprinkle the grated Parmesan cheese over the last layer of sauce.
  • Cover the baking dish with aluminum foil and place in the preheated oven for about 30-40 minutes, or until the lasagna is bubbly and the cheese is melted.
  • Remove the foil during the last 10 minutes of cooking to brown the top of the lasagna.
  • Remove from the oven and let the lasagna rest for a few minutes before serving. Garnish with fresh basil leaves, if desired.
